Anthony: "Mary?"

She'd been in a meadow, surrounded by flowers. Suddenly she was plunged into darkness, Anthony's voice calling to her. The darkness slowly faded into a bright, orange light, and Mary opened her eyes. She found herself face-to-face with Anthony, unsure of where she was or how she got there. She blinked a few times as the memory of the previous night slowly came back to her.


Mary: "Hi."

Anthony smiled.

Anthony: "Hi. Did you sleep well?"
Mary: "Apparently. What time is it?"
Anthony: "It's eight o'clock."
Mary: "Eight o'clock? I can't have been asleep for more than five minutes."
Anthony: "Eight P.M. I have to get to my shift at the hospital."


Mary: "You let me sleep all day?"
Anthony: "You needed the rest. In fact, I'm going to take you home and I want you to go straight back to sleep."
Mary: "If you say so. It's not like I have a job to get to."
Anthony: "Come on, then. I've got the car running already."

Anthony helped Mary to her feet and she followed him out to the car. The walk was enough to sap whatever energy she'd had upon waking, and she slid into the passenger seat with a sigh of relief. Anthony closed the door and walked around the car, getting into the driver's seat and pulling out of the driveway.


Mary: "I've never been so tired in my entire life. Not even when I had pneumonia. Or hypothermia."
Anthony: "Really?"
Mary: "No, I'm totally exaggerating. Hypothermia is a bitch."

Anthony chuckled.


Mary: "I think I'll go apply for a job at the library. That place seems good and boring."
Anthony: "I can't really see you working in a library."
Mary: "Are you kidding? I'd be brilliant. I'm great at scowling at people and shushing them."
Anthony: "And yet not that great at enjoying the quiet yourself."
Mary: "Maybe I could use a bit more quiet."
Anthony: "I suppose it couldn't hurt. Well, here we are."

Anthony stopped and shut off the car, then rushed to Mary's door to help her out.


Mary: "I'm just tired, I'm not actually wounded."
Anthony: "You were shot, you had your nose punched in by a door, and you seem to be limping."
Mary: "I think I twisted my ankle kicking one of those stupid kids. But it's fine. Nothing a little Ibuprofen won't fix."

Anthony helped her to the door, watched as she unlocked thirty-seven or so locks, and then helped her to a chair in the kitchen.


Mary: "Thanks."
Anthony: "Are you sure you'll be okay alone?"
Mary: "I'll be fine, I promise. Go to work and save someone else's life for a change."
Anthony: "Yes ma'am. Here's my pager number, call if you need anything."
Mary: "Sure thing."


Mary watched as Anthony left. Once she could no longer hear his car, she stood up, hobbled to the refrigerator and got out the milk, then grabbed a bowl from the cupboard. She reached for her box of cereal, finding it alarmingly light, and poured out nothing but a small note that read, 'Sorry!!! Beer in the fridge. Love, Markus.'

She took a deep breath and let it out slowly. It was one thing to be attacked by killers and vampires. It was quite another to come home to an empty box of Count Chocula, betrayed once again by someone who was supposed to be your friend.

She put the milk away, grabbed a beer, and went in search of pajamas, stopping along the way to fill the bathtub with warm, sudsy water. She prayed that by the time she got out, Alton Brown would be on the Food Network to distract her from the lack of chocolaty, crunchy goodness.


Mary: "You would not believe the night I had. First of all, Markus seems to have eaten all of my Count Chocula."
Emily: "He did? Are you sure it wasn't… I mean, that bastard!"
Mary: "I know! Who even let him in here, anyway?"


Mary: "And then-hey, are you even listening to me?"
Emily: "Isn't that Bellie's?"


Newscaster: "Tonight, police and the fire department are still investigating a fire that destroyed a local favorite diner in Deception Pass. There were no injuries or fatalities as the diner was shut down earlier yesterday morning while police investigated two separate hostage situation that occurred last night. In the first, two suspects shot and killed a police officer before fleeing. A second officer is still missing. Following that, William Billington, who is accused of killing his girlfriend and her lover, took two hostages before police shot him. Billington is recovering from a single gunshot wound and is in critical condition. One of the diner's servers was also injured in the scuffle. She was treated and released at the scene."


Mary: "Well that about sums things up, with the obvious exception of the involvement of several vampires. I can't really imagine how things could have gone any worse."
Newscaster: "In other news, local businessman and multi-millionaire Andrew Stone put in his bid for Mayor of Deception Pass this afternoon."


Mary/Emily: "You've got to be kidding me!"
